Binti Contracts Guidance

Counties should assess their need for a Binti contract extension by evaluating current expiration dates against the volume and projected completion timeline of in-progress RFA applications. Once active processing in Binti ends, instances may be shifted to read-only access.

Because Binti data conversion is targeted for August 2027, counties are strongly advised to include early termination provisions to maintain flexibility if timelines shift. Additionally, counties intending to retain a local copy of their Binti data extracts must establish secure storage protocols prior to transition.

While the COTS waiver funding select counties expires in October 2026, the CWS-CARES Project is actively seeking approval for an extension via an As-Needed request. As a reminder, an Advance Planning Document (APD) is required for any initiation, amendment, or renewal of software licensing agreements for child welfare external systems, and written State approval must be obtained prior to executing any contract changes.

Additional contract guidance is available on the CWDS Frequently Asked Questions | Child Welfare Digital Services.

181 Report Planning

Please note that while CWS-CARES will capture the necessary data, it must be accumulated over time before full automated reporting is available in CWS-CARES.

Guidance on reporting steps across CWS-CARES, Binti, and legacy systems remains under review. The California Department of Social Services (CDSS) will provide formal direction at Go-Live outlining both interim reporting procedures and the long-term process for generating the 181 Report. Specific steps across CWS-CARES, Binti, and legacy systems are currently under review pending final decisions on converted data dependencies.

New Binti Data Validation Workshop Series

A new biweekly meeting series, the Binti Data Validation Workshop has been scheduled on Thursdays from 1:00 PM to 2:30 PM starting September 24 to November 12, 2026, with a kickoff session scheduled separately on Thursday, September 10 at 10:30 AM. The workshop series invitation was sent on August 20, 2026 to Binti County Single Points of Contact (SPOCs), Implementation Coordinators (ICs), and DCVAL / CARES 105 Users.

This collaborative forum will be used to support county data validation and cleanup, review conversion results and defects, address anomalies, and discuss upcoming action items, with flexible agendas tailored to current priorities and county needs. Counties are encouraged to forward the invite to any additional relevant staff.

To better connect program, CWS-CARES development and practice knowledge with data conversion of these systems, Jeff Dent, Service Manager for Resource Family Homes, will facilitate these sessions and lead the program efforts for CWS-CARES V1 External System Data Conversion. Naomi Robledo has transitioned to other branch priorities and will no longer be involved in this effort.

External Systems Data Conversion Opt-Out Process

While integrating external system data into CWS-CARES offers significant value, we recognize that the high level of effort required for conversion may outweigh the benefit for every county. Counties seeking to opt out of external system data conversion for CWS-CARES V1 must submit a formal request from their County Child Welfare Director to the CDSS Child Welfare System Branch Chief via the CWDS External Stakeholder Coordination Unit mailbox using the External System Data Conversion Opt-Out Letter Template provided here: External System Data Conversion Opt-Out Letter Template (Word) (PDF).

This request must outline a clear business rationale—such as existing data parity in CWS/CMS or reduced operational effort—and include a commitment to fully adopt CWS-CARES V1 at Go-Live for all applicable child welfare activities including Resource Family Approval (RFA), Emergency Placements, Family Finding, and Resource Family Homes (RFH). Furthermore, counties must submit a transition plan to detailing how existing active records will be managed prior to Go-Live, ensuring all new cases originate directly in CWS-CARES and the external system is shifted to Read-Only access no later than July 31, 2027.

Additionally, the submission must explicitly acknowledge that the State will not convert this data at a later date and that the county assumes full financial and operational responsibility for retaining legacy data for audit compliance.

Security Protocols for Prod Sim Case Data

The Prod Sim environment contains converted CWS/CMS cases reflecting actual system data as of April 17, 2026. Because this includes real, sensitive Personally Identifiable Information (PII), all case information must be strictly protected or redacted.

To protect CWS-CARES case data, please follow these important security guidelines when working with our support teams:

  • Redact Ticket Info: Do not send Protected Health Information (PHI), PII, or confidential case details to the Service Desk via email or ticket. Sensitive and confidential data cannot be stored in the ticketing system.
  • Secure Screen Shares: During support-requested screen shares, limit attendees to essential personnel only. Recording of sensitive information is strictly prohibited.
  • Consult for Tier 3 Transfers: If Tier 3 support needs sensitive data, use secure transmission methods. Contact your county Privacy Officer or the CWDS ISO if you need assistance with secure routing.
